This movie is (was as of me typing this) released by Mill Creek Entertainment.
I purchased my copy in DVD format.
This movie is part of the Tsuburaya/Ultraman franchise.
The movie is short in length but that did NOT bother me.
There are cameos of cast/characters from previous Ultraman series.
Be warned this is a comedic take on Ultrama.
The hero in this story tries to muster up courage to do battle/fight the bad guys.
He enrolls in a dojo to train.
The team group is called Mydo (Mysterious Yonder Defense Organization). They have the proverbial team headquarters and equipment too.
There is a capsule monster too. I liked the capsule monster. It looked weak at first but was able to do a good job. The villain that Ultraman Zearth must defeat is a cyborg.
I liked this entry. It might be better enjoyed by a younger audience.
But I liked it. A true Ultraman fan would not mind adding this into their collection (as I have).
